Timings

The best time to visit with groups is Monday to Friday, as weekends can get extremely busy.  

We recommend approximately 1hr to 90min for the visitor experience. It is always best to build in additional time when visiting with a group.

Please arrive at your booked entry time slot.  

  • Time slots are open daily from 9:50 to 16:10. On the first Saturday of each month time slots open from 12:50.  
  • The maximum number of people per time slot is 60. Groups bigger than 60 will be split across two time slots. Depending on capacity on the day, our Attraction team might split your group over two time slots even if your group is smaller than this.  

Getting here

  • Tower Bridge is a red route which means there can be no stopping at any time.
  • Coaches can drop-off and collect from the Tower Hill car park, where it is free for 15 minutes. Many coaches also drop off and collect from Tooley Street.
  • Always check for updates the day before your visit in case of road works or closures.

Terms and conditions

  • All groups of children must be supervised by a minimum ratio of one adult per 15 children.
  • Groups of students aged 16-17 years must be accompanied by a minimum of one adult per 30 students.
  • All adults supervising children or students are required to remain with their group throughout the visit and be on hand to take any instructions from our team.
  • Groups of more than 30 persons will be required to split into smaller sections before entering and must remain apart throughout the visit to prevent congestion.
